Abstract

Single crystals of Ag(In0.5Al0.5)S2 were grown by chemical vapor transport using ICl3 as a transport agent. The as-grown Ag(In0.5Al0.5)S2 essentially shows dark red and its absorption edge close to red-to-green energy portion. The stoichiometric content of the Ag(In0.5Al0.5)S2 was evaluated by energy dispersion X-ray spectroscopy. The X-ray diffraction measurement confirmed that the crystal is single phase and crystallized in the chalcopyrite structure. The lattice constants of the crystals were determined to be a = 5.763 ± 0.08 A and c = 10.623 ± 0.016 A, respectively. Raman spectroscopy revealed a prominent A1 (282 cm−1) peak (i.e. main characteristic mode), which verified the chalcopyrite structure of the Ag(In0.5Al0.5)S2. The absorption-edge anisotropy of the Ag(In0.5Al0.5)S2 has been studied by polarization-dependent transmission measurements with the linearly polarized lights along \({\text{E}}\parallel \,{ }\) (denoted as E‖) and along \({\text{E}} \bot \,{ }\) (denoted as E⊥) onto the {112} plane of the crystal. The unpolarized band gap determined by transmission measurement was about 2.31 ± 0.01 eV, which is lying in between the lower E‖ (~2.24 ± 0.01 eV) and higher E⊥ (~2.40 ± 0.01 eV) polarized gaps. The absorption-edge anisotropy by the E‖ and E⊥ polarizations has been clearly demonstrated herein. On the basis of the experimental results, the structure and optical band edge of the Ag(In0.5Al0.5)S2 is thus realized.
